    Good choice. Essentially it's like a compact video version of the manual covering almost anything in the main program you need to know. It makes it easier to understand the terms and methods used in Sonar and although it should get you through almost any task within Sonar if you need ultra finite detail about something you will know what search for in the 2000 page manual and/or how to ask about/describe stuff here on the forum more accurately.
     
    Thing is though within its 9 hours + of vids it doesn't dig into how to work all the specific effects and synths that come bundled. Just how to use the DAW. However all those individual units can be very complex on their own and require individual study. That's why I mentioned the other Intruments and FX vids which are just as thorough but goes through each of those things one by one.
     
    I have pretty much watched all those vids from start to finish just to get a general idea of what is and does what but now what I do is if I need to perform a specific task I will go and rewatch the specific entry on the Sonar feature, effect and/or synth I intend to use. Then if need be I will scour the PDF Reference Guide which I keep stored on my laptop for extra info or do a Google search of the topic which generally brings up the online versions of the reference guide (which is updated regularly), threads here on the forum discussing the issue and sometimes youtube videos or articles on other sites about the task.
